Market Overview:
The global Palm Vein Recognition in Healthcare Market size was valued at USD 1.2 billion in 2022 and is expected to reach USD 3.5 billion by 2032, growing at a CAGR of 17.5% during the forecast period.

Palm vein recognition technology is expected to be one of the major contributors to this growth. Increasing Demand for Contactless Biometric Identification: The COVID-19 pandemic has accelerated the adoption of contactless biometric identification solutions in healthcare settings, as it reduces the risk of infection transmission. Palm vein recognition technology is an ideal solution for contactless biometric identification as it is non-invasive and does not require physical contact with the device. Growing Need for Secure Patient Identification: Patient identification errors are a common problem in healthcare, which can lead to medical errors and patient safety risks. Palm vein recognition technology provides a highly secure and accurate method of patient identification, which can help reduce the risk of errors and improve patient safety. Advancements in Technology: The palm vein recognition technology has been advancing rapidly in recent years, with the development of more accurate and reliable sensors and algorithms. These advancements have improved the performance and usability of the technology, making it more attractive to healthcare providers.

Increasing Adoption of Electronic Health Records: The adoption of electronic health records (EHRs) is growing rapidly worldwide, which is creating a significant opportunity for palm vein recognition technology. By using palm vein recognition, healthcare providers can securely access patient records and ensure that only authorized personnel have access to sensitive information. Government Initiatives and Regulations: Governments worldwide are investing in healthcare IT infrastructure and promoting the adoption of electronic health records, which is driving the growth of the palm vein recognition market. Additionally, regulatory bodies are enforcing the use of secure patient identification methods to comply with data protection regulations, which is creating a significant opportunity for palm vein recognition technology.

Overall, the palm vein recognition market is expected to grow rapidly in the coming years, driven by the increasing demand for secure and contactless biometric identification solutions in healthcare settings. The technology's high accuracy, non-invasiveness, and ease of use make it an attractive solution for healthcare providers, which is likely to contribute to market growth.

Geographical Analysis:
Currently, North America dominates the palm vein recognition market in healthcare due to the region's high adoption of advanced healthcare technologies and the presence of several leading market players. In the US, the adoption of electronic health records (EHRs) has been increasing rapidly in recent years, which is driving the demand for secure and accurate patient identification solutions like palm vein recognition. Additionally, the US government has been promoting the use of biometric identification methods in healthcare settings to improve patient safety and reduce medical errors, which is also contributing to the growth of the market. Several leading companies in the palm vein recognition market are based in North America, including Fujitsu Ltd., M2SYS Technology, NEC Corporation, and Hitachi Ltd. These companies offer a range of palm vein recognition solutions for healthcare applications, such as patient identification, medical record access, and medication dispensing.

For instance, Fujitsu has developed a palm vein recognition system called PalmSecure, which is used in several healthcare facilities in North America for patient identification and medical record access. The system uses near-infrared light to capture palm vein patterns, which are unique to each individual, and converts them into biometric templates for secure and accurate identification. Moreover, the increasing demand for contactless biometric identification solutions in healthcare facilities due to the ongoing COVID-19 pandemic is likely to further drive the growth of the palm vein recognition market in North America.
Overall, North America is expected to continue to dominate the palm vein recognition market in healthcare in the coming years, driven by the region's high adoption of healthcare IT solutions, the presence of leading market players, and the increasing demand for secure and contactless biometric identification solutions in healthcare settings.
Recent Development: Global Palm Vein Recognition in Healthcare Market
• In September 2020, Fujitsu Frontech North America announced the launch of its new PalmSecure Truedentity solution for contactless biometric authentication. The solution combines Fujitsu's PalmSecure palm vein recognition technology with identity management software to provide a secure and convenient authentication solution for various industries, including healthcare.
• In August 2020, M2SYS Technology, a leading provider of palm vein recognition solutions, announced that it had been awarded a General Services Administration (GSA) IT 70 Schedule contract for its biometric software and hardware products. The contract allows M2SYS to offer its solutions to government agencies and organizations in the US.
• In July 2020, Hitachi Ltd. announced the launch of its new biometric authentication system, which uses palm vein recognition technology for secure and contactless authentication. The system is designed for various applications, including healthcare, finance, and government.
